Finland has a long and well-deserved reputation for innovation in education which appears to yield results, with its universities recently ranking as the highest performing in the world. Within its higher education system, the country has two over-arching goals:

– Offer learning environments that are among the best in the world, and,
– Provide flexible and personalized study paths to ensure its future workforce are fully equipped for success.

Our new case study, Three Visions, One Aim. Delivering a World Class Education in Finland, reveals how the University of Turku, Tampere University of Technology, and Lappeenranta University of Technology use Echo360 video and lecture capture technology to help reach these goals.

In the study, you will learn how these institutions use Echo360 to:

– Bring teaching and learning directly to students through video live-streaming and recordings.
– Support cutting-edge teaching methods such as flipped classrooms.
– Increase student flexibility with on-demand access to their course content and lecture videos.
– Scale to meet the demands of more students as a university expands to four separate campuses.
